How long does a wheel bearing replacement take?

How long does a wheel bearing replacement take? Rear wheel drive, tapered roller bearing: about 15-45 minutes; wear gloves or spend another 10 minutes washing grease off your hands. Front wheel drive with pressed on bearing: 30–120 minutes depending on whether it can be pulled off and pressed in with a specialty tool. How to replace a front wheel hub assembly? What does the p0016 Ford diagnostic code mean? P0016 FORD Meaning This Diagnostic Trouble Code (DTC) sets when the Powertrain Control Module (PCM) detects Variable Camshaft Timing (VCT) position misalignment between the camshaft and crankshaft. The test fails when the misalignment is one tooth or greater. When was the Ford Flex p0016 built? P0012, P0016, P0018, P0021, P0022. Vehicle may also exhibit rough idle or misses. Follow the service procedure steps to correct this condition. 1. Using IDS, verify DTCs are present. 2. Verify vehicle build date on or before 12/15/2008. Where is the low pressure a / C charge port? The port is along the fire wall right behind the air filter, you may actually even need to remove the filter box to re charge. the low side a/c charge port is behind the air filter box and you will need to remove the filter and box to access it. What was the average MPG rating in 1975?

What was the average MPG rating in 1975? vehicle efficiency increased steadily throughout the early 1980s as the fuel economy law was phased in. Between 1975 and 1985, average passenger- vehicle mileage doubled from about 13.5 mpg to 27.5, while fuel economy for light trucks increased from 11.6 mpg to 19.5.
